Key facts
The Advanced Certificate in Marketing Contracts equips students with specialized knowledge and skills essential for managing and negotiating marketing agreements effectively. Participants will learn to draft, review, and negotiate various types of contracts commonly used in marketing, such as influencer agreements, sponsorship deals, and advertising contracts. By the end of the program, students will be able to analyze contract terms, identify potential risks, and create mutually beneficial agreements that protect all parties involved.
This certificate program typically spans over 8 weeks and is designed to be completed at the student's own pace. The flexible schedule allows working professionals to acquire valuable contract management skills without disrupting their current commitments.
